Output 68da41a63665d389b2bb9ec49c8d7056cd00a611306d4f0f7bc28ae6960eef82:1

value
644804895
script pubkey
OP_0 OP_PUSHBYTES_32 f8b5e271bbae9f96070b5121dbe0c17567d8b1416b0848a2657b22c37a23ff08
address
bc1qlz67yudm460evpct2ysahcxpw4na3v2pdvyy3gn90v3vx73rluyqng2w7a
transaction
68da41a63665d389b2bb9ec49c8d7056cd00a611306d4f0f7bc28ae6960eef82
confirmations
246299
spent
true